WordPress: Editing Files:修订间差异
Seadragon530(讨论 | 贡献) 无编辑摘要 |
无编辑摘要 |
||
第1行: | 第1行: | ||
__TOC__ | __TOC__ | ||
你可能有很多次需要编辑WordPress文件,特别是如果你想要对你的[[Wordpress:Using Themes|WordPress 主题]]做出更改时。WordPress有2个内置的编辑器可以在线时在浏览器内编辑文件:[[Wordpress:#Using the File Editor|文件编辑器]]和[[Wordpress:#Using the Theme Editor|主题编辑器]]。你也可以编辑复制过来的或者存储在你电脑上的文件,然后使用[[Wordpress:FTP Clients|FTP 客户端]]上传到你的网站。 | 你可能有很多次需要编辑WordPress文件,特别是如果你想要对你的[[Wordpress:Using Themes|WordPress 主题]]做出更改时。WordPress有2个内置的编辑器可以在线时在浏览器内编辑文件:[[Wordpress:#Using the File Editor|文件编辑器]]和[[Wordpress:#Using the Theme Editor|主题编辑器]]。你也可以编辑复制过来的或者存储在你电脑上的文件,然后使用[[Wordpress:FTP Clients|FTP 客户端]]上传到你的网站。 | ||
在开始编辑WordPress文件之前,请检查如下内容: | 在开始编辑WordPress文件之前,请检查如下内容: | ||
;备份!使用备份来操作:如果可能的话使用复件或备份文件操作,或者确定你会在做出更改后时常[[Wordpress:WordPress Backups|备份你的信息]]。把备份放在安全的地方。 | ;备份!使用备份来操作:如果可能的话使用复件或备份文件操作,或者确定你会在做出更改后时常[[Wordpress:WordPress Backups|备份你的信息]]。把备份放在安全的地方。 | ||
;[[Wordpress:Changing File Permissions|文件许可]] :当在线操作时,为了修改文件,你不得不为文件许可做出适当的设置以允许修改。如果你看到了WordPress内置编辑器面板的底部的注释'''"如果本文件可写,就可以进行编辑."''',这意思是说你对某文件做出更改的时候需要改变文件的许可。 | ;[[Wordpress:Changing File Permissions|文件许可]] :当在线操作时,为了修改文件,你不得不为文件许可做出适当的设置以允许修改。如果你看到了WordPress内置编辑器面板的底部的注释'''"如果本文件可写,就可以进行编辑."''',这意思是说你对某文件做出更改的时候需要改变文件的许可。 | ||
;使用 [[Wordpress:Glossary#Text editor|文字编辑器]] 来编辑文件 :如果你要使用外部编辑器对文件做出更改,就用文字编辑器。'''不要使用字处理程序.'''字处理程序改变标点符号,还有可能改变字体或者带来一些不想要的代码,这些都有可能导致文件使用时崩溃。因为这个原因,还有些HTML自动生成程序也不宜使用。 | ;使用 [[Wordpress:Glossary#Text editor|文字编辑器]] 来编辑文件 :如果你要使用外部编辑器对文件做出更改,就用文字编辑器。'''不要使用字处理程序.'''字处理程序改变标点符号,还有可能改变字体或者带来一些不想要的代码,这些都有可能导致文件使用时崩溃。因为这个原因,还有些HTML自动生成程序也不宜使用。 | ||
== 使用文件编辑器== | == 使用文件编辑器== | ||
WordPress包含了一个内置的编辑器,允许在线时在浏览器内直接编辑文件。叫做'''文件编辑器'''。 | WordPress包含了一个内置的编辑器,允许在线时在浏览器内直接编辑文件。叫做'''文件编辑器'''。 | ||
从[[Wordpress:Administration Panels|管理]] > | 从[[Wordpress:Administration Panels|管理]] > | ||
[[Wordpress:Administration_Panels#Manage_-_Change_your_content|操作]] > [[Wordpress:Manage_Files_SubPanel|文件面板]]进入内置编辑器。 | [[Wordpress:Administration_Panels#Manage_-_Change_your_content|操作]] > [[Wordpress:Manage_Files_SubPanel|文件面板]]进入内置编辑器。 | ||
* 想在文件编辑器中查看文件, 点击列表中的文件,或者输入详细地址,如 <tt>example.com/wordpress/filename.php</tt> | * 想在文件编辑器中查看文件, 点击列表中的文件,或者输入详细地址,如 <tt>example.com/wordpress/filename.php</tt> | ||
** '''如果文件"[[Wordpress:Changing_File_Permissions|可写]]"''' (允许更改), 你会在编辑窗口底部看到一个按钮,写着'''更新文件'''。 当你完成更改后,点击它,准备保存文件。 | ** '''如果文件"[[Wordpress:Changing_File_Permissions|可写]]"''' (允许更改), 你会在编辑窗口底部看到一个按钮,写着'''更新文件'''。 当你完成更改后,点击它,准备保存文件。 | ||
第47行: | 第23行: | ||
* 在文件编辑器窗口里,你可以对文件进行改动。编辑的时候要小心,不要把一些文件内部的代码删除或者损坏。 | * 在文件编辑器窗口里,你可以对文件进行改动。编辑的时候要小心,不要把一些文件内部的代码删除或者损坏。 | ||
* 准备保存文件时,点击底部的'''更新文件'''按钮。文件就被保存了。 | * 准备保存文件时,点击底部的'''更新文件'''按钮。文件就被保存了。 | ||
== 使用主题编辑器 == | == 使用主题编辑器 == | ||
WordPress包含了一个内置的编辑器,允许直接从浏览器编辑编辑主题文件。叫做'''主题编辑器'''。 | WordPress包含了一个内置的编辑器,允许直接从浏览器编辑编辑主题文件。叫做'''主题编辑器'''。 | ||
从[[Wordpress:Administration Panels|管理]] > | 从[[Wordpress:Administration Panels|管理]] > | ||
[[Wordpress:Administration_Panels#Presentation_-_Change_the_Look_of_your_Blog| | [[Wordpress:Administration_Panels#Presentation_-_Change_the_Look_of_your_Blog|模板]] > [[Wordpress:Administration_Panels#Presentation_-_Change_the_Look_of_your_Blog|主题编辑器面板]]进入主题编辑器 | ||
点击列表中的文件可以在主题编辑器中查看文件。 | 点击列表中的文件可以在主题编辑器中查看文件。 | ||
有关编辑主题的更多信息可以在[[Wordpress:Theme Development|主题开发]]和[[Wordpress:Using Themes|使用主题]]中找到。 | 有关编辑主题的更多信息可以在[[Wordpress:Theme Development|主题开发]]和[[Wordpress:Using Themes|使用主题]]中找到。 | ||
== 脱机编辑文件 == | == 脱机编辑文件 == | ||
想要在你的电脑上脱机编辑文件,可以使用任何[[Wordpress:Glossary#Text editor|文字编辑器]],打开文件做出改动。当然要确定你的原文件已经备份。 | 想要在你的电脑上脱机编辑文件,可以使用任何[[Wordpress:Glossary#Text editor|文字编辑器]],打开文件做出改动。当然要确定你的原文件已经备份。 | ||
'''如果你准备改动任何核心WordPress文件,做个记录并把它们用文本文件保存在你的WordPress根目录下,做出备份,以便将来参考和更新。''' | '''如果你准备改动任何核心WordPress文件,做个记录并把它们用文本文件保存在你的WordPress根目录下,做出备份,以便将来参考和更新。''' | ||
保存文件之后,使用[[Wordpress:FTP Clients|FTP客户端]]上传到相应的WordPress网页文件夹中。然后在你的浏览器中查看结果,看是否想要的更改已经生效。 | 保存文件之后,使用[[Wordpress:FTP Clients|FTP客户端]]上传到相应的WordPress网页文件夹中。然后在你的浏览器中查看结果,看是否想要的更改已经生效。 | ||
==什么文件可以被编辑? == | ==什么文件可以被编辑? == | ||
第105行: | 第52行: | ||
* .htaccess | * .htaccess | ||
* TXT (相关的类似文本的文件如 RTF) | * TXT (相关的类似文本的文件如 RTF) | ||
== 须知 == | == 须知 == | ||
第117行: | 第58行: | ||
;'''即时更改''':你在WordPress编辑器中所做出的更改是即时的,你不需要使用FTP客户端程序。你是在线更改文件。你和访问者可以立即看到更改结果。 | ;'''即时更改''':你在WordPress编辑器中所做出的更改是即时的,你不需要使用FTP客户端程序。你是在线更改文件。你和访问者可以立即看到更改结果。 | ||
; '''出错了? 使用备份文件''':编辑之前备份所有的文件。如果你出了什么错误,把备份文件复制回来。没有备份?你就需要重新下载WordPress、主题、和其他你需要替换的文件然后重头再来。首先备份。 | ; '''出错了? 使用备份文件''':编辑之前备份所有的文件。如果你出了什么错误,把备份文件复制回来。没有备份?你就需要重新下载WordPress、主题、和其他你需要替换的文件然后重头再来。首先备份。 | ||
第125行: | 第64行: | ||
'''出了更大的错误? 删除''':如果你做出的改动导致你的网页"崩溃"了、给出空白页或者页面到处都是错误,如果你不能进入管理面板,删除改动过的文件然后用一个备份中正常的文件替换它。 | '''出了更大的错误? 删除''':如果你做出的改动导致你的网页"崩溃"了、给出空白页或者页面到处都是错误,如果你不能进入管理面板,删除改动过的文件然后用一个备份中正常的文件替换它。 | ||
=== 使用这些编辑器的警告 === | === 使用这些编辑器的警告 === | ||
第146行: | 第75行: | ||
* 任何可以自定义即时网页的软件 | * 任何可以自定义即时网页的软件 | ||
当你对他们''非常''熟悉的时候可以使用以下软件: | 当你对他们''非常''熟悉的时候可以使用以下软件: | ||
第156行: | 第81行: | ||
*FrontPage – 注意FrontPage 插入的多余的代码,不要试着使用它的内置模板…同时注意一些IE特效代码,可能会造成你的页面在某些特定浏览器中非正常显示,你肯定不想这样,因为你希望在所有浏览器中都可以正常浏览,所以务必确认已经排除了IE特效代码,否则你的blog注定要失败。所以,必须一直保持谨慎,及时删除IE特效代码。 | *FrontPage – 注意FrontPage 插入的多余的代码,不要试着使用它的内置模板…同时注意一些IE特效代码,可能会造成你的页面在某些特定浏览器中非正常显示,你肯定不想这样,因为你希望在所有浏览器中都可以正常浏览,所以务必确认已经排除了IE特效代码,否则你的blog注定要失败。所以,必须一直保持谨慎,及时删除IE特效代码。 | ||
推荐编辑器被列在[[Wordpress:Glossary#Text_editor|术语表的文字编辑器部分]] | |||
{{Copyedit}} | {{Copyedit}} |
2008年4月10日 (四) 14:48的最新版本
你可能有很多次需要编辑WordPress文件,特别是如果你想要对你的WordPress 主题做出更改时。WordPress有2个内置的编辑器可以在线时在浏览器内编辑文件:[[Wordpress:#Using the File Editor|文件编辑器]]和[[Wordpress:#Using the Theme Editor|主题编辑器]]。你也可以编辑复制过来的或者存储在你电脑上的文件,然后使用FTP 客户端上传到你的网站。
在开始编辑WordPress文件之前,请检查如下内容:
- 备份!使用备份来操作
- 如果可能的话使用复件或备份文件操作,或者确定你会在做出更改后时常备份你的信息。把备份放在安全的地方。
- 文件许可
- 当在线操作时,为了修改文件,你不得不为文件许可做出适当的设置以允许修改。如果你看到了WordPress内置编辑器面板的底部的注释"如果本文件可写,就可以进行编辑.",这意思是说你对某文件做出更改的时候需要改变文件的许可。
- 使用 文字编辑器 来编辑文件
- 如果你要使用外部编辑器对文件做出更改,就用文字编辑器。不要使用字处理程序.字处理程序改变标点符号,还有可能改变字体或者带来一些不想要的代码,这些都有可能导致文件使用时崩溃。因为这个原因,还有些HTML自动生成程序也不宜使用。
使用文件编辑器[ ]
WordPress包含了一个内置的编辑器,允许在线时在浏览器内直接编辑文件。叫做文件编辑器。
- 想在文件编辑器中查看文件, 点击列表中的文件,或者输入详细地址,如 example.com/wordpress/filename.php
- 如果文件"可写" (允许更改), 你会在编辑窗口底部看到一个按钮,写着更新文件。 当你完成更改后,点击它,准备保存文件。
- 如果文件"不可写", 你会看见编辑窗口底部有一个注释,说明该文件不可写。你需要通过一个FTP程序(推荐 FileZilla)对文件进行CHMOD操作,改为666以把文件变为可写状态。
- 编辑之前,把你的文件进行备份!'
- 在文件编辑器窗口里,你可以对文件进行改动。编辑的时候要小心,不要把一些文件内部的代码删除或者损坏。
- 准备保存文件时,点击底部的更新文件按钮。文件就被保存了。
使用主题编辑器[ ]
WordPress包含了一个内置的编辑器,允许直接从浏览器编辑编辑主题文件。叫做主题编辑器。
点击列表中的文件可以在主题编辑器中查看文件。
脱机编辑文件[ ]
想要在你的电脑上脱机编辑文件,可以使用任何文字编辑器,打开文件做出改动。当然要确定你的原文件已经备份。
如果你准备改动任何核心WordPress文件,做个记录并把它们用文本文件保存在你的WordPress根目录下,做出备份,以便将来参考和更新。
保存文件之后,使用FTP客户端上传到相应的WordPress网页文件夹中。然后在你的浏览器中查看结果,看是否想要的更改已经生效。
什么文件可以被编辑?[ ]
通过使用WordPress内部编辑器,在可写状态下,以下几种文件格式可以编辑:
须知[ ]
- 文件许可
- 要通过内置文件编辑器编辑文件,该文件的许可必须设置为666。你可以通过FTP 客户端程序、你的主机提供的基于网络的操作界面、使用telnet或者ssh (secure shell) 的命令行 更改许可。这些操作取决于你的主机提供什么类型的访问通路。
- 即时更改
- 你在WordPress编辑器中所做出的更改是即时的,你不需要使用FTP客户端程序。你是在线更改文件。你和访问者可以立即看到更改结果。
- 出错了? 使用备份文件
- 编辑之前备份所有的文件。如果你出了什么错误,把备份文件复制回来。没有备份?你就需要重新下载WordPress、主题、和其他你需要替换的文件然后重头再来。首先备份。
- Make a Bigger Mistake? Delete
- If the changes you make cause your site to "crash" or gives you a blank screen or screen filled with errors, if you cannot access your Administration Panels, delete the changed file and replace it with a good one from your backup.
出了更大的错误? 删除:如果你做出的改动导致你的网页"崩溃"了、给出空白页或者页面到处都是错误,如果你不能进入管理面板,删除改动过的文件然后用一个备份中正常的文件替换它。
使用这些编辑器的警告[ ]
不要使用以下这些软件编辑WordPress文件,实在不要用:
- Microsoft Word
- WordPerfect
- 任何字处理软件
- Microsoft Publisher
- 任何可以自定义即时网页的软件
当你对他们非常熟悉的时候可以使用以下软件:
- Dreamweaver – 最好从WordPress 编辑器中复制出来,覆盖默认情况下Dreamweaver在新文件中的内容
- FrontPage – 注意FrontPage 插入的多余的代码,不要试着使用它的内置模板…同时注意一些IE特效代码,可能会造成你的页面在某些特定浏览器中非正常显示,你肯定不想这样,因为你希望在所有浏览器中都可以正常浏览,所以务必确认已经排除了IE特效代码,否则你的blog注定要失败。所以,必须一直保持谨慎,及时删除IE特效代码。
推荐编辑器被列在术语表的文字编辑器部分
This article is [[WordPress::Category:Copyedits|marked]] as in need of editing. You can help Codex by editing it.